What is IRCTC E-Ticket Cancellation Service?

e-Tickets can be cancelled on Internet at this website till Chart preparation of the train .Cancellations are not allowed at face to face Railway Counters. If the user wishes to cancel his e-Ticket, he can do so till the time of chart preparation for the train.For train starting up to 12 noon the chart preparation is usually done on the previous night.

He can log on to www.irctc.co.in and go to “Booked Tickets” link and select the ticket to be cancelled and can initiate the cancellation by selecting the passengers to be cancelled. Cancellation would be confirmed online and the refund would be credited back to the account used for booking as for normal Internet tickets.

If there is any partial cancellation of ticket, please ensure that a fresh e-reservation slip (Electronic Reservation Slip) is printed separately as done for the original ticket. To take you step by step and familiarize you with the procedure for canceling of e-tickets

How To Cancel IRCTC Train Ticket?

Step-1: If user wishes to cancel the e-ticket, log on to www.irctc.co.in then go to ‘My Transactions’ and Click ‘Booked Ticket History’ link on the menu bar, select the ticket to be cancelled and click on ‘Go For Cancellation’ and can initiate the cancellation by selecting the passengers to be cancelled.

Step-2: User has to select only those passangers who are to be cancelled in case of partial cancellation of ticket. in case of partial cancellation the passanger should get a fresh printout of the ERS for the passangers continuing their journey.

Step-3:If the ticket is partially cancelled, a fresh Electronic Reservation Slip needs to be carried by the Passenger

Cancellation of e-Tickets before chart preparation of the train:
1. If a confirmed ticket is cancelled more than 48 hrs before the scheduled departure of the train, flat cancellation charges shall be deducted @ Rs.240/- for AC First Class/Executive Class, Rs.200/- for AC 2 Tier/First Class, Rs. 180 for AC 3 Tier/AC Chair car/ AC 3 Economy, Rs.120/- for Sleeper Class and Rs.60/- for Second Class.

2. Cancellation charges are per passenger. If a confirmed ticket is cancelled within 48 hrs and up to 12 hours before the scheduled departure of the train, cancellation charges shall be 25% of the fare subject to the minimum flat rate mentioned in the above clause.

3. Less than 12 hours and upto four hours before the scheduled departure of the train up to chart preparation which is earlier, 50% of the fare paid subject to the minimum cancellation charges. Note the Chart preparation time is the time for the chart preparation from the Train Originating Station or from the previous chart Preparation station.

Cancellation of e-Tickets after the preparation of Reservation charts:
** For Normal User, E-ticket cannot be cancelled after chart preparation. Users are requested to use the online TDR filing for such cases and track Status of the refund case through tracking service provided by IRCTC.

** No refund of fare shall be admissible on the tickets having confirmed reservation in case the ticket is not cancelled or TDR not filed online upto four hours before the scheduled departure of the train.

** No refund of fare shall be admissible on RAC e-tickets is case the ticket is not cancelled or TDR not filed online upto thirty minutes before the scheduled departure of the train.

Cancellation of e-tickets in case of trains cancelled:
If the train is marked as “CANCELLED” in PRS due to breaches, floods, accidents etc. full refund is permissible in case the ticket is cancelled within three days of the scheduled departure of the train. In case of e-tickets, such cancellations can be done by the customer through Internet.

Additional Simplified Procedure

You can cancel your IRCTC e-ticket online up to 4 hours before the scheduled departure of the train in case of confirmed tickets. In case of RAC/WL tickets, you can cancel your ticket up to 30 minutes before the scheduled departure of the train.

To cancel your e-ticket online, you need to follow these steps:
** Go to the IRCTC website: https://www.irctc.co.in
** Login to your account.
** Click on the “Booked Tickets” tab.
** Select the ticket that you want to cancel.
** Click on the “Cancel Ticket” button.
** Enter the reason for cancellation.
** Click on the “Submit” button.

Your ticket will be cancelled and the refund amount will be credited to your IRCTC account. You can check the status of your refund by going to the “Cancelled Tickets” tab.

Here are some of the important things to keep in mind when cancelling your IRCTC e-ticket online:
** You can only cancel your e-ticket online if it has not been boarded yet.
** You will not be able to cancel your e-ticket after the scheduled departure of the train.
** The refund amount will be credited to your IRCTC account within 7-10 working days.
** If you have cancelled your ticket due to a medical emergency, you can submit a medical certificate to IRCTC for a full refund.
